Exelon was recently separated into two publicly traded companies, Exelon and Constellation. Exelon is the parent company for our fully regulated transmission and distribution utilities, delivering electricity and natural gas to more than 10 million customers. Constellation is the largest supplier of clean energy and sustainable solutions to homes, businesses and public-sector customers across the continental U.S., backed by more than 31,000 megawatts of generating capacity consisting of nuclear, wind, solar, natural gas and hydro assets. PRIMARY DUTIES AND ACCOUNTABILITIES
  • Perform Scheduled and Unscheduled Maintenance on Company Aircraft to FAA and OEM standards. (20%)
  • Order, receive, and ship aircraft parts and materials per company, FAA, and IATA standards. (20%)
  • Ensure aircraft are maintained I/A/W FAA and Manufacturer recommended maintenance programs (20%)
  • Monitor, project, and oversee aircraft off-site maintenance and keeping to company budgetary requirements. (20%)
  • Perform arrival and departure duties including assisting passenger loading and crew servicing coordination. (10%)
  • Perform Flight Technician duties on assigned international trips (5%)
  • Accept additional duties assigned by the Chief of Maintenance (5%)

JOB SCOPE

Flight Mechanic is responsible for keeping company corporate aircraft to stringent high safety standards. Provides out senior executives with reliable and safe travel accommodations. Forecasts and builds budgets through the course of the fiscal year. Keeps abreast of all new technologies which are specific to industry. Keeps to high levels of business attire both when working at the company facility and away to keep to the high levels of visibility our positions have in the organization.

Qualifications

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
  • FAA A&P License(Violation Free) with completion of Inspector Authorization within 3 years of employment
  • 5 years Corporate Aircraft Maintenance Experience
  • Microsoft Office and Apple IOS operating experience

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• 10 Years Corporate Aircraft Maintenance Experience
  • Company aircraft past experience.
  • Avionics/Airframe or Engine/Airframe Experience. Associate's Degree preferred but not required.
